I need 2 more exams (preferably graded or 6 credit pass/fail ones for the most GPA impact) before graduating. I have a very limited time to study and complete these. I just completed Supervision yesterday and it fit the criteria perfectly. I'm basically looking for two easy A grades through Excelsior. This is my available list of exams to choose from:
1) Analyzing & Interpreting Lit. - No IC cards/non-graded/6 credits. I know nothing about literatrure and poetry but I have good reading comprehension. Prefer reading about sports, health, human performance, etc.
2)Env.&Hum.Race/Save Planet
3)Ethics in America
4)Foundations of Education
5)Intro to Business - I have taken OB, HRM, Management and Supervision
6)Intro to World Religions
7)Intro to Computing - No IC cards for this particular one. I Scored a 63 on MIS 1.5 years ago, however I still consider myself pretty computer illiterate)
8)FEMA Credits - Just discovered this option. Does the whole TESC credit bank (one flat fee) and then transfer to Excelsior thing work or do you need to fork out $60 per credit through Fredricks? Couldn't find definitive answer.

From what I've heard from others, as well as my EC advisor...you can credit bank FEMA credits at TESC for a flat fee of $380 (depending on how many credits you need). If you only need 6 credits...then you'd be better off going through Fredericks & saving yourself $20.
I found the Analyzing & Interpreting Lit. almost too easy. Also, Ethics in America is a pretty easy one....IF you are remotely a history buff at all. I took that one right after taking all my Western Civ (I & II) & US History (I & II) exams. From that point, it was fairly simple...throw in a couple hours of IC cards & you're good to go. A&I Lit. is only awarded Pass/Fail credit by Excelsior. It will not effect your GPA one way or the other.
Since you have had other business core classes and MIS. I would take Intro to Business and Intro to Computing. Use the IC Clep computer exam cards to study with.
